On Fri, Aug 08, 2003 at 12:02:10AM +0200, Christian Bartl wrote: > Dear Gentoo users, > > as I have problems with ALSA since the last upgrade of > alsa-libs/driver/utils I verified the permissions of /dev/dsp and > noticed that there are several device owned by the user I normally login > as. > > I cannot remember that I have ever changed anything here. > Any suggestions how this can happen. May I change ownership of these > file to root?
Take a look at /etc/security/console.perms On login and logout file ownership is set according to the specification in that file. If you want other perms that the given ones, I make the changes in the console.perms (man 5 console.perms) Thomas
